A slot is a casino game that works by spinning reels and paying out according to the rules of the game. There are many different types of slot machines, but the majority of them share a similar design with some common features like a pay line and a reel configuration.
The key to winning at slot is to understand the game’s rules and how they apply to each spin. A player’s chances of winning are determined by the combination of symbols that appear on a payline. Slot machines have varying payout values depending on the amount of money a player bets and how the paylines are arranged. It is also important to understand the volatility of each slot machine, as this indicates how often it pays out.

The problem is that losing streaks can quickly erode their bankroll. This is where a slot strategy can help players avoid going broke.
A good slot strategy begins with setting a budget for how much you’re willing to spend on each session. It’s crucial to stick to this budget like it’s super glue and not to let your emotions get the best of you. It’s also a good idea to find a slot with a high RTP to ensure that you’re getting the most out of your playtime.
